Chavi Bansal (on hiatus)
Chavi Bansal, born in India, began her dance career as a Bollywood background dancer. She holds a B.A. in Dance and Choreography from Fontys Hogescholen Voor de Kunsten (Netherlands) and a Master’s in Education from Harvard University. Blending Indian classical and Western modern techniques, her work has been showcased internationally at venues like Danstaliers (Netherlands) and India Habitat Center, University of Stavanger (Norway). Since 2010, she has led her company, Vimoksha, empowering communities through dance outreach in Massachusetts. A 2022 Massachusetts Cultural Council Choreography Fellow, Chavi has taught Bollywood at over 30 libraries, schools, and programs across the state. She has also been a visiting professor, and guest lecturer, at several universities, including Mount Holyoke College, University of Massachusetts, Amherst, and Smith College.
